they perform the same, an old school RT uses a gas-through bolt(banjo bolt) and rail.

the RTP has a newer design of the valve that doesnt need a gas through bolt or rail so it can use parts(body/rail/trigger frame) from the mini and classic(or you can put the RTP valve in mini or classic)

the newer RTP's come with an Iframe stock.

I wouldnt buy the old school RT, I'd buy the RTP, but that's just me.

It all your want is performance and dont care for the looks, save money and buy a Retro valve/Iframe. You would even still be able to buy a level ten all for less than the cost of a new RTP.

In all, I agree, except to point out the RT Pro uses a different Sear and Rail...more like the emag in some ways with the screw sear pin. And a slightly different Body like th Emags with a different shaped "pennel" (sp?) that will work on a Classic or Mini but not the other way around without some minor dremel work.
